Transaction 839538f260e36487e65b9c2a4b4aa568a68e4aa6c3b58220214ca3a3c8eea136

3 Input
2 Outputs
  • 839538f260e36487e65b9c2a4b4aa568a68e4aa6c3b58220214ca3a3c8eea136:0
  • value  38705567
    address  12DGzkFxU8U7YCSZYgQbwptiTC7iXr7xAC
  • 839538f260e36487e65b9c2a4b4aa568a68e4aa6c3b58220214ca3a3c8eea136:1
  • value  395000000
    address  1AcVpBNpyXkZyWy8Bb7K1RkhT7UjVqMztr